Output fd12151bb988b61e74f8f4688bd9eeb278d020e000624758dfb69b17b11c4ed7:7

value
3013709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81314048a6bfc138a71166f4b14807aa08892858 OP_EQUAL
address
3DU86KLHR7ntAmpphqCjbfGox3siG4qsY5
transaction
fd12151bb988b61e74f8f4688bd9eeb278d020e000624758dfb69b17b11c4ed7
spent
true